The new millennium opens with major investments: in 2001, SILTE decides to focus on instrumental innovation, inserting a new Mazak metal laser cutting system in the carpentry department, which also leads to the expansion of the warehouse dedicated to them.
In 2004, 3D parametric modelling became SILTE's heritage, SolidWorks complements more traditional computer-aided design with two-dimensional Cad. In 2005 SILTE launches Sil-block® a new line of patented products for acoustic insulation in homes and acquires a share of the domestic and foreign market in the building sector.
In 2010 Acustiko® was presented, a revolutionary anti-noise panel for mobile barriers on building sites and beyond. In 2011, the integral soundproofing system for heat pumps called UTA-Protect® was tested.
